Just a lot to like about this printer and nothing I don't like. Very capable for the price. I do mostly black and white printing, rarely print photos. (This will supposedly do a credible job of photo printing too but I haven't tried it). If you want professional caliber photo printing, you probably want the Epson 8550 which is similar to this, a bit more expensive, but does 6 color printing. If you are doing more like every day business printing the 15000 might be a better choice because it's built more for speed. The tank system means I can just replace the black because I use it a lot. The black ink tank is double size of the others and based on my experience so far, I think I'll easily get over a thousand pages on the standard-vivid setting which is very strong black but still relatively high speed printing. Given that the black ink bottles are under $30 I think the cost per page will be comparable to laser. The booklet/pamphlet printing can be complicated to work out with layers of PDF software and the Epson printer driver. But once you work it through, it's super capable. I've printed a lot of 12 x 18 double-sided for booklets and the paper handling has been flawless. (It can duplex automatically for 8 1/2 x 11 but for other sizes you have to manually duplex, which you can do by printing back/front or even/odd.) It's not as fast as a laser printer but it's pretty fast -- inkjets have improved so much.
